Business Combination
A merger or acquisition in which separate companies come together to form a single entity, often to enjoy strategic advantages or to expand their market reach.
Group Accounts
Financial statements that combine the accounts of a parent company with those of its subsidiaries, presenting the financial position and results of operation of the group as a single economic entity.
